This Quick Reference Guide provides all the necessary information to install the Savant

Smart Host.
IMPORTANT! Before using the Savant Smart Host for the first time, update
to the latest version of Runtime OS.
Follow the steps outlined in the Software Installation and Upgrade
Deployment Guide for the release being installed.
NOTE: The Savant Smart Host is a custom Linux host designed specifically to support
running a Savant Runtime OS. Use of other Linux devices is not supported by
Savant.

Specifications
Environmental Environmental
Temperature 0C to +40C
Humidity 10% to 90% Relative Humidity (non-condensing)
Cooling 10 CFM
Maximum BTUs 61.5 btu/hr
Dimensions and Weight Dimensions and Weight
Height 1.55in (39.0mm)
Width 4.59in (116.6mm)
Depth 4.41in (112.0mm)
Weight (Shipping) 6 lb
Rack Space 1U (2 chassis per 1 rack unit)
Power Power
Power Supply 19V DC 65W 50/60 Hz
Compliance Compliance
Safety and Emissions FCC Part 15 | C-Tick | CE Mark
RoHS Compliant
Rear Panel
! " # $ %
1 Power Supply Connection to 19V DC power supply (Included).
2
USB 2.0
Ports (x2)
Connection for USB devices such as keyboards/mouse or
USB memory stick.
3 Cooling Vents
Provides cooling for the internal components.
WARNING! DO NOT block vents in order to maintain proper
cooling.
4
HDMI Outputs
(x2)
19-pin Type A HDMI female; digital video/audio outputs; signal
types HDMI, DVIcompatible with DVI/D (requires DVI to
HDMI adapter, not included), allowing DVI/D source signal to
be passed to displays. Limited to 185 MHz pixel clock.
5 Network LAN
RJ-45 Ethernet 10/100/1000 base-T, auto-negotiating port
with link/activity LEDs.
Front Panel
1
USB
2.0 Port
Connection for USB devices such as wireless keyboards/mouse, or USB
memory stick.
Top Panel
1 Power Button
Use to power On or Off the HST. Icon glows Blue when
powered on.
2 HDD LED
Solid or Flashes indicating SSD activity. Will increase to solid
with more activity.

Power Management Recommendations
Savant recommends a pure sine wave uninterruptible power supply (UPS) with the ability
to shut down the HST Host Controllers before the battery runs out of power. Never
remove power from the HST Host Controller before shutting it down.
Network Connection Requirements
Savant requires the use of business class/commercial grade network equipment throughout
the network to ensure the reliability of communication between devices. These higher
quality components also allow for more accurate troubleshooting when needed.
Connect all Savant devices to the same local area network (LAN), virtual local area network
(VLAN), or subnet as the host to ensure they can be located via the Bonjour protocol. Devices
connected to separate LANs, VLANs, or subnets will not communicate as the Bonjour protocol
cannot cross to other networks.
Network Configuration
To ensure that the IP address of the Savant Smart Host will not change due to a power
outage, a static IP address or DHCP reservation should be configured. Savant
recommends using DHCP reservation within the router. By using this method, static IPs
for all devices can be managed from a single UI avoiding the need to access devices
individually.
